Job Description

WHAT'S THE JOB?

The Manager, IFM Solutions & Estimating, will work in collaboration with the wider SSI and Operations teams, will lead the preparation of solution development and estimation of new integrated facilities management work throughout Canada. Prepare recommendations on financial analyses, operating efficiencies, and business opportunities, development of financial proformas for Hard, Soft and Integrated FM opportunities.

  • To manage pricing response process for IFM services including all Hard and Soft Maintenance Tasks which may include: Plant Maintenance, Building Automation, Other Technology, Help Desk Services, Waste Management and Pest Control, Grounds and Landscaping, Roads and Parking Lot Services, and various Soft FM services in accordance with the RFP and client specifications.
  • Both Lead (where appropriate) and participate in the Kick-Off Meeting, weekly strategy meetings, and any formal meetings pertinent to ensuring the estimate and bid process will meet the milestone dates established

Pre-Bid

  • Developing and maintaining costing models for each business line – with support from Finance Pricing / Cost Analyst and input from Business Development
  • To work with the operational teams to govern the use of estimating models and review estimate packages to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Work in partnership with other areas of the business to provide a consistent approach to our operations including finance, procurement, HR. This will consist of assessing elements of the delivery and working to provide a best practice solution.
  • Complete project scope of work reviews to ensure completeness of estimates, and that all technical specifications, subcontractor scopes, and general condition items have been quantified and costed
  • Propose and approve potential bid strategies, operability requirements, and advantages or innovations to increase bidding success
  • Responsible for estimating and cost planning activities including taking ownership of and presenting the final cost plan/estimate to the operations team.
  • Contact and analyze subcontractor bids for irregularities and ensure the full scope of work is included
  • Set-up and complete estimates in company standard estimating program
  • Prepare preliminary maintenance schedules based on self-perform productivities and subcontractor input
  • Assemble all elements based on client scope of work - of an estimate including labour, material, equipment, and subcontractor pricing
  • Provide detailed labor breakdowns for each area to assist with budget creation and management of the project
  • Attend and participate in site visits, pre-bid meetings, and post-bid meetings as required

Post-Bid

  • Attend estimate approval meetings with management to review estimate details, assumptions, and risk factors
  • Analyze and propose potential strategies, advantages, or innovations for the project that could provide Dexterra with a more competitive bid
  • Participate in closing the bid including bid review meetings, etc.
  • Participate in hand over meeting with Project management team after award.

Sales and Operations Support

  • Training and teaching operations on the models produced and how to integrate benchmarks into each costing exercise.
  • Attend Strategy, Kick-Off and estimate review meetings as required
  • Ability to decide as part of a team which projects have potential for Dexterra to pursue and execute and which to decline, based on complexity, schedule, client, resources, and target market.
  • Provide leadership for the business development team on major complex projects pursuits.
  • Develop coaching and mentoring skills with the Finance and Operations team throughout all aspects of the estimating process
  • Reviewing project to develop a win strategy
  • Ability to critically review request for proposals, Scopes of Work, estimates, proposals, and both external and internal information to enable best decisions to be made in consultation with management.
  • In conjunction with the Operations or Sales lead communicate with client to gather information, clarify specifications, wording, etc.

Other Key Responsibilities

  • A full understanding of the commercial implications of design, maintenance and lifecycle decisions.
  • Take full accountability as the main point of contact for work winning IFM Bid Price response This includes all service delivery solutions, labour and equipment maintenance strategies and associated task lists/work instructions.
  • Participate with the SSI group to develop ongoing IFM opportunities driving cost efficiencies through a proactive approach, best practice and continuous improvement across all hard and soft FM service lines
  • Seek opportunities to improve services and cost effective ways of working.
  • To interact with all internal teams to discharge the consistent, effective and efficient delivery of planned and reactive tasks and in doing so, support best practice.
  • Responsible for ensuring statutory and legislative compliance of relevant equipment within the operation
Qualifications

WHO ARE WE LOOKING FOR?

  • High school graduate and completion of a diploma training program at a college or technical school; Gold Seal Certified, LEED Accredited, and LEAN experience are all assets or extensive experience in a mechanical contracting trade (Eng or CET considered an asset) or, 3+ years' relevant Mechanical Estimating experience with strong exposure across organizing and preparing cost estimates and proposals for IFM projects.
  • Ability to understand, utilize, and communicate specialized and technical information in speech and written text
  • Advanced degree of aptitude in comprehending tender documents, specifications, and drawings, with an understanding of contractual requirements
  • Works effectively in a team environment
  • Produce detailed estimates, and or proposal development for opportunities.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, time management, and multi-tasking to prioritize workload and stay on top of things as project demands increase
  • Self-motivated with a strong willingness and ability to learn and be challenged
  • Computer skills and kn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, Outlook, Excel, Powerpoint, Teams, Access, Project)
  • Knowledge in H.V.A.C. or mechanical systems is an asset.
  • Experience with pricing platforms, systems and programs.
  • Eligible to work in Canada
  • Membership of Relevant Professional Organizations such as the Canadian Institute of Quantity Surveyors (CIQS); The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ors (RICS); and/or Association for the Advancement of Cost Engineering (AACE) is an asset
  • Reliability clearance with the Government of Canada is an asset but not essential
